RUCKUS AI RRM manages Wi-Fi environments so customers don’t have to
Today’s enterprise networks are increasingly difficult to manage. A major challenge, the radio environment is highly dynamic, complex and continuously changing. More client devices are mobile and roaming throughout buildings and venues, while technologies such as the internet of things (IoT) introduce new challenges to the wireless environment.
Additionally, with the introduction of the 6 GHz spectrum, Wi-Fi® networks have many choices with multiple frequency bands, channels, and channel widths. The 6 GHz spectrum alone has 59 distinct channels, whereas 5 GHz only offers up to 25.
While it may seem counterintuitive, this abundance of choice results in burdensome Wi-Fi spectrum management and an increased likelihood of higher RF interference, resulting in poorer-performing networks. RF interference is arguably the single biggest performance issue with modern Wi-Fi networks.
运作方式
Cloud monitoring
AI RRM operates in the cloud and utilizes proprietary techniques to monitor the network and identify wireless performance issues. Every day, it runs in the background, assessing the current state of the network. AI RRM constantly monitors the network for any radio interference that may have developed due to changing network conditions.
Minimize RF interference
Once per day, AI RRM assesses the latest wireless data analysis and suggests modifications to access point (AP) configurations to reduce the RF interference as low as possible. It utilizes three primary Wi-Fi radio characteristics to control the performance of the AP: transmit (Tx) power, operating channel, and/or channel bandwidth.
Maximum flexibility
As part of IntentAI, AI RMM provides network administrators with the option to either configure for the highest throughput or maximum client density. For highest throughput, it adjusts the operating channel to minimize co-channel interference. For maximizing client density, it may adjust Tx power, operating channel, and channel bandwidth. By managing the network’s RF environment using AI RRM, IT staff can automate the complexities of channel planning, allowing them to focus on other, more proactive strategies.
